public async Task <ApiJsonResultData> GetCatalog([FromQuery] UiCatalogParam param)
        {
            return(await new ApiJsonResultData().RunWithTryAsync(async y =>
            {
                var userBase = await GetUserBaseInfo();
                if (userBase != null)
                {
                    var inputInpatientInfo = new CatalogParam()
                    {
                        验证码 = userBase.验证码,
                        CatalogType = param.CatalogType,
                        机构编码 = userBase.机构编码,
                        条数 = 500,
                    };


                    var inputInpatientInfoData = await _webServiceBasicService.GetCatalog(userBase, inputInpatientInfo);
                    if (inputInpatientInfoData.Any())
                    {
                        y.Data = inputInpatientInfoData;
                    }
                }

                //var data = await webService.ExecuteSp(param.Params);
            }));
        }
 public async Task <ApiJsonResultData> DeleteCatalog([FromQuery] UiCatalogParam param)
 {
     return(await new ApiJsonResultData().RunWithTryAsync(async y =>
     {
         var userBase = await GetUserBaseInfo();
         var data = await _webServiceBasicService.DeleteCatalog(userBase, Convert.ToInt16(param.CatalogType));
         y.Data = data;
     }));
 }